50 Most Influential Churches for 2006

(Filed under: Examples)

The Church Report has released their list of the 50 Most Influential Churches for 2006 (1.9 MB PDF, 9 pages). The list is compiled by recommendations from leaders of 2,000 of the largest churches, so "influential" is a bit fuzzy (yes, we did recently have that debate when we belatedly linked to last year's list).
